Overview
- Coinhouse received full Crypto Asset Service Provider (PSCA) authorization from France’s AMF in May 2026, a move the AMF whitelist now shows as active.
- The authorization covers seven services including brokerage, custody, transfers, investment advice, and crypto portfolio management.
- Coinhouse upgraded from its 2020 PSAN registration after a multi-year compliance effort that was advised by law firm De Gaulle Fleurance.
- With PSCA status Coinhouse gains EU passporting, which it says it will use to expand regulated offerings to retail, corporate and institutional clients in other member states.
- MiCA replaces national PSAN rules and requires providers to hold PSCA authorization by July 1, 2026 or stop serving French clients and face criminal and large administrative fines.
